I had been to Andaman & Nicobar Islands last year..
Flights tickets are available for cheaper rates, if you book for both to and fro travel.
However, rates depends on the season also.
By flight you can reach Portblair within one and half hours from Chennai.
I think there are flights available from Kolkatta also.
As Ritesh ji said, the ship journey is bit difficult. If you are in a holiday mood, you may not be enjoying it. Make sure the seats are booked in Deluxe class.
For Nicobar Islands, you may need "Tribal Pass" also, which can be obtained from Deputy Commissioner office. Am not sure whether the tribal pass is necessary for tourists.
However, in Nicobar conditions are worst after the tsunami. You may have to book boats to go to Indira point, as the roads are totally destroyed during tsunami. anyway you can visit associate group of islands..
